Day two, evening Hollywood Studios!
Okay, heres my preface: I SHOULD have known better. Really.
DH and I arent truly that interested in shows. We like rides, or interactive stuff; to sit through a 20 minute show doesnt really do it for us. And DD scares easily. That was a big problem with DHS, as you will see. But I FELT we SHOULD go to the studios. I mean, were THERE, lets take in as much as we can.
DD would like the Playhouse Disney show (with mickey / einsteins / handy manny / pooh), and wed try to hit either Beauty and the Beast or Ariel while were there. Oh, and I thought the Muppets 3D would be a great intro experience for her before going to Philharmagic the next day.
So the plan was: after our mid day break, we were headed to DHS.
We had a 5:20 dinner at Hollywood and Vine, on the Fantasmic dinner plan. [Remember I mentioned that DD scares easily? Yeah
. my sister went to Fantasmic years ago with her family (2 teenage daughters) and stressed how this is THE BEST show she has ever been to including shows outside of Disney THE BEST! We HAVE to go!
Again, I SHOULD have known better.
]
We got to DHS and strolled up to the board listing all the shows available in the next few hours. Granted, we only had a couple hours, but surely Ariel would sing to us HOLD ON A MINUTE
check the watch
. check the board
. the watch (5:05)
. the board (last show 4:50 / last show 5:00 / last show 4:45 / etc)
aw, mannnnn
.. Okay, we need a new plan.
Refocus and head to Hollywood and Vine. I had some trepidation about the food, as the DIS boards seem to dis it (haha, get it?) quite frequently.
But we were pleasantly surprised! Perhaps it was the glowtini, but we had a lovely meal.
The choices were quite varied, and the desserts were to die for!
DD's plate
DD had a tinkerbell drink but our waitress very kindly served it in a regular cup so we could take the souvenir cup home, clean and dry.
After dinner, we headed over to
Muppets 3D I knew the movie was older, so the quality of 3D would be less than the new movies, and DD would be less startled by it. Luckily, this was a success! She really did enjoy the movie, and at least didnt run screaming from the theater.
After that we had a little time to kill before our reserved seats @ Fantasmic, so we strolled around Yikes!
What a confusing area! We were looking for the DISboards recommended singing in the rain umbrella I knew it was in the Streets of New York area, but it took a while to find it. Id love to give you directions, but all I can say is to turn at the San Francisco street scene,
follow the New York street to the end, and hang a left and walk until you see it on the corner.
We hit a couple dead ends trying to leave, but we made it to the front gate right in time for Fantasmic.
Okay, so here is THE SHOW that we HAD to see. Hm, how to put this. Yes, it is a fantastic show.
Really. The movie screens of mist were very cool. The story seemed vague if you hadnt read about it before hand, but the PRODUCTION was really great. That being said, the moment Maleficent showed up
(about ¼ way into the show), DD shoved her head in my armpit and wouldnt take it out until the boat of good guys / heroes / princesses circled around.
So would we do DHS again? You can probably guess my answer.
Maybe when DD is a teenager
but not any time soon. Thats just us, though I think it made it tougher because we had had such a great morning at AK and a little piece of me would have much rather another ½ day there. Also, the early close resulted in no shows after 5:00 (perhaps someone else could address whether this happens when the park closes later?); Ill chalk this one up to a learning experience.
